Maximize Efficiency with the Right Enterprise Search Engine

Enhance productivity using an enterprise search engine in a collaborative office scene.

Understanding the Enterprise Search Engine

In the rapidly evolving landscape of information management, the enterprise search engine emerges as a pivotal tool. This software not only allows organizations to sift through vast amounts of internal data but also to unlock insights that can significantly influence business outcomes. By integrating various data silos into a single searchable interface, enterprises can enhance their efficiency and decision-making capabilities.

What is an Enterprise Search Engine?

An enterprise search engine is a powerful software solution designed to index, search, and retrieve information stored across an organization. Unlike traditional search engines, which typically search the internet, enterprise search engines focus on finding structured and unstructured data within an organization’s ecosystem. This includes content from databases, documents, emails, intranets, and more. The ultimate goal is to streamline the searching process, making it faster and more efficient for users to find relevant information.

Key Components of an Enterprise Search Engine

Understanding the architecture of an enterprise search engine is crucial for organizations looking to implement such a system. Key components include:

  • Indexing System: Captures data from various sources and catalogues it in a manner that makes retrieval efficient.
  • Search Interface: Allows users to input queries and receive results in a user-friendly format.
  • Security and Permissions: Ensures that sensitive data remains protected by restricting access based on user roles.
  • Analytics and Reporting: Provides insights into search patterns and usage metrics, assisting in continuous improvement.

How Enterprise Search Engines Work

The functionality of an enterprise search engine revolves around its ability to assimilate and process data from various internal systems. The workflow typically includes:

  1. Data Collection: The engine fetches data from various sources like databases, cloud repositories, and document management systems.
  2. Indexing: The collected data is indexed, making it searchable. This includes parsing the content and creating a searchable index.
  3. User Queries: Users input their queries, which the engine translates into search requests across the indexed data.
  4. Results Ranking: The engine then ranks the search results based on relevance, often using algorithms to prioritize the most pertinent information.
  5. Result Presentation: Finally, results are presented to the user, often accompanied by filters and refinement options for enhanced navigation.

Benefits of Using an Enterprise Search Engine

Organizations adopting an enterprise search engine can expect numerous benefits that enhance their operational efficiency and knowledge management:

Improved Information Retrieval

With a well-implemented enterprise search engine, employees can access the information they need within moments, rather than wasting hours hunting through emails or disparate data sources. The precision and speed of enterprise search capabilities drastically reduce the time spent on searching, leading to significant productivity gains.

Enhanced Collaboration and Knowledge Sharing

Enterprise search engines foster a culture of collaboration by breaking down silos. Users can easily share insights and documents within teams, ensuring that knowledge is readily accessible to all. By facilitating smooth information exchange, these systems enable teams to work together more effectively, regardless of their physical locations.

Increased Productivity in Organizations

The impact on productivity is undeniable. Employees can focus more on their core responsibilities rather than searching for information. As the time spent on locating information decreases, overall efficiency increases, leading to more accomplished goals and objectives. This ripple effect can enhance the company’s bottom line over time.

Implementing an Enterprise Search Engine

Effectively implementing an enterprise search engine requires a strategic approach, focusing on the organization’s unique needs while assessing the available solutions in the market.

Evaluating Your Organization’s Needs

The first step is to assess what specific needs your organization has regarding data retrieval. Identifying the types of data users need, how they access it, and the pain points experienced with the current systems is key to establishing the right criteria for an enterprise search solution. Stakeholder interviews, feedback sessions, and data audits can help unveil these requirements.

Selecting the Right Solution

Based on the organization’s needs, the next step is to scout and evaluate potential enterprise search solutions. Factors to consider include:

  • Customization: How adaptable is the solution to your existing data structures?
  • Scalability: Can the search engine grow with your organization?
  • Integration: Does the engine integrate well with your current tools and infrastructure?
  • Cost: What is the pricing structure, and does it fit your budget?
  • User Experience: Is the search interface intuitive and user-friendly?

Integration and Launch Strategies

Once a solution is selected, the integration phase begins. This can be complex, depending on the number of data sources and systems to connect. Key strategies include developing a timeline, ensuring thorough testing, and providing training for end users. A phased rollout can also mitigate risks, enabling organizations to adapt to the new system gradually.

Measuring Success with Your Enterprise Search Engine

The implementation of an enterprise search engine should not be considered complete without a comprehensive strategy for measuring its success. This typically involves tracking performance through key metrics and implementing continuous improvement practices.

Key Performance Metrics to Track

Some essential metrics include:

  • Search Success Rate: Percentage of successful searches that lead to user satisfaction.
  • Time to Result: Average time users take to find the information they need.
  • User Engagement: Frequency of searches conducted and user interaction rates.

Continuous Improvement Techniques

Continuous improvement can be achieved by regularly analyzing collected data, observing user behavior, and soliciting user feedback. Updating the indexing process, enhancing search algorithms, and refining user interfaces are all ways to ensure the search engine remains effective over time.

Feedback and User Adoption

For measuring user adoption, organizations can conduct surveys and gather qualitative feedback from users. The goal is to understand their experiences with the search engine and identify potential areas for further training or improvement. User satisfaction surveys, site usage analytics, and stakeholder discussions can provide valuable insights.

The landscape of enterprise search is constantly evolving, influenced by technological advancements and emerging industry needs. Understanding these trends can position organizations to leverage their enterprise search engines effectively.

The Role of AI in Enterprise Search

Artificial Intelligence is increasingly at the forefront of enhancing the capabilities of enterprise search engines. AI-driven technologies can provide personalized search results, automate categorization, and improve natural language processing, making the interactions more intuitive for users.

Emerging Technologies Shaping Search Engines

Advancements in machine learning and natural language processing continue to shape the future of enterprise search. These technologies can better understand user intent and context, leading to more accurate searches and improved relevance in results. Additionally, the integration of voice search and mobile accessibility will redefine user interactions with enterprise search engines.

Preparing for Industry Changes and Challenges

Organizations must remain agile to adapt to these changes. Continuous training, updates, and agile methodologies can empower teams to respond to shifts in technology effectively. Additionally, understanding compliance considerations and data security throughout changes will become increasingly vital.

FAQs

What is an enterprise search engine?

An enterprise search engine is software designed for finding and retrieving data from various internal sources within an organization, facilitating quick access to structured and unstructured data.

How does enterprise search enhance productivity?

By reducing the time spent searching for information, enterprise search engines enable employees to focus on core tasks, leading to significant productivity improvements across the organization.

What metrics should I track post-implementation?

Key metrics to track include search success rates, time to result, and user engagement levels, helping to measure the effectiveness of the search engine.

How can I ensure user adoption of the new search engine?

Providing comprehensive training, soliciting feedback, and continuously improving based on user experiences can enhance user adoption of the enterprise search engine.

What technologies are shaping the future of enterprise search?

AI, machine learning, and natural language processing are pivotal in shaping the future, enabling more intuitive search experiences and personalization for users.